The 2nd Galaxy Entertainment Group Macao International Shorts Film Festival collaborates with “Venice Days” at the Venice International Film Festival to promote outstanding short films and film culture in Macao

The “2nd Galaxy Entertainment Group Macao International Shorts Film Festival”, jointly organised by the Cultural Affairs Bureau and the Galaxy Entertainment Group, has established a partnership with the “Giornate degli Autori” (Venice Days), a prestigious sidebar of the Venice International Film Festival.

Cultural Affairs Bureau presented Macao’s diverse publications and cultural and creative brands at the 35th Hong Kong Book Fair

The Cultural Affairs Bureau (IC, from the Portuguese acronym) and the Macao Foundation jointly set up the “Macao Pavilion” at the 35th Hong Kong Book Fair, showcasing Macao’s high-quality publications and unique cultural essence to readers from Hong Kong and other regions.

Cultural Affairs Bureau instals “Cultural Macao-Macao Pavilion” in the China (Shenzhen) International Cultural Industries Fair

The 21st China (Shenzhen) International Cultural Industries Fair (ICIF) is being held at the Shenzhen World Exhibition & Convention Centre from 22 to 26 May 2025. The Cultural Affairs Bureau is participating with the “Cultural Macao‧Macao Pavilion”, sponsored by MGM, to showcase Macao’s unique cultural heritage, intangible cultural heritage preservation, cultural events and performances, and cultural creativity.
